September is hot and humid. Spring in general has the best weather, and is considered by most to be the. Because of the cooler spring weather and big festivities, february to may is the best time to visit new orleans.

The best time to visit new orleans is from february to may when the weather is comfortably cool and the celebrations are in full swing. Best time to avoid large crowds. January 29th to may 13th.

Since mardi gras is new orleans’ main event, it’s no surprise that everything in town is way more expensive during the celebrations.
